Third annual fundraiser for Women’s Network P.E.I. goes Nov. 6

-

Women’s Network P.E.I. will host the third annual Celebrate Island Women fundraiser in Charlottet­own on Tuesday, Nov. 6.

It will take place at the Florence Simmons Performanc­e Hall with the reception beginning at 6 p.m. and the performanc­e getting underway at 7 p.m.

Tickets are $50 (tax and fees included) and can be purchased online through TicketPro or in person at the Florence Simmons Performanc­e Hall box office.

Judy Herlihy, chairwoman of the board of directors, said it is a great platform to showcase and celebrate the artistic talents of local women, as well as allow the group to raise funds to help support its continued efforts in promoting gender equality locally while elevating the voices of all Island women.

“It really is incredible how the community has rallied around this event and come out to show their support,’’ Herlihy said.

Returning this year is awardwinni­ng singer-songwriter powerhouse Irish Mythen, who will be master of ceremonies. With live performanc­es from Tara MacLean, Tamara Steele, Colleen MacQuarrie, Kindra Bernard, Bing Yiao and others this jam-packed evening will feature live music from award winning artists, inspiring cultural dance, and laughout-loud comedy.

In addition to live performanc­es, there will also be a silent auction featuring items from local business and Island artisans.
